The four reasons roofing companies lose jobs to competitors with the same quality work

No photo upload on the quote form

Most homeowners cannot describe roof damage accurately over the phone or in a message. A form that lets them upload a photo of the damaged area means you arrive at every quote already knowing the scope of the job. It saves time, improves your quote accuracy, and signals professionalism before you even visit.

Not appearing for storm and seasonal searches

Roofing enquiries spike after storms. Homeowners search for roofers in their area within hours of the damage occurring. If your website does not appear for local searches and your Google Business profile is incomplete, you miss the highest intent customers in your market.

No way to track which jobs came from which source

You run Google ads. You post on Facebook. You hand out flyers. You get referrals. But which of these is actually sending paying customers? Without source tracking you are spending marketing budget in the dark. Knowing which channels work means you can double down and stop wasting money.

Following up too slowly

Roofing quotes are competitive. Homeowners often request quotes from two or three roofers at the same time. The one who follows up fastest and most professionally wins the job. A pipeline with follow up reminders means no warm lead ever goes cold because it got buried in your inbox.

Why most service business websites get traffic but no enquiries

The problem is rarely the website design. It is usually the same five things.

The page title does not say what you do or where you do it

Google uses your page title to understand what your page is about. A title like Tree Removal and Stump Grinding in Austin TX tells Google exactly what to rank you for. This single change can move a business from invisible to page one for local searches.

The Google Business profile is incomplete

Most local customers never go past Google Maps. If your profile does not have your service area, a clear description, photos of your work, and a link to your website, you are invisible to people ready to hire.

The contact form is buried

If someone has to navigate to a separate contact page to find your form, most of them will not do it. The enquiry form needs to be visible above the fold on your homepage.

The website talks about the business, not the customer's problem

Nobody searches for 15 years of family owned experience. They search for emergency roofer near me or tree removal same week.

Nobody knows the website exists

A website with no directory listings takes months to appear in Google search. Listing your business on Yelp, local directories, and Google Business sends signals to Google that your business is real.
